Imprinted DNA methylation reprogramming during early mouse embryogenesis at the Gpr1-Zdbf2 locus is linked to long cis-intergenic transcription.
FEBS letters - 23 Mar 2012
Kobayashi Hisato, Sakurai Takayuki, Sato Shun, Nakabayashi Kazuhiko, Hata Kenichiro, Kono Tomohiro
Abstract excerpt
The paternally-expressed imprinted genes Gpr1 and Zdbf2 form a gene cluster wherein the imprinted-methylated regions of these two genes differ. We identified a novel, paternally expressed, long intergenic non-coding Zdbf2 variant (Zdbf2linc) transcribed from maternally methylated Gpr1 DMR during early embryogenesis in the mouse.
